Abstract
A method for calculating ion energy losses during the charge-exchange process is proposed. It is established that the contribution of the charge-exchange process to inelastic energy losses for ions with nuclear charges of Z = 5–10 is significant and reaches 15% for certain ions in the energy interval of 30 to 100 keV/nucleon. If a gas target is replaced with a solid one, the ion energy losses during the charge-exchange processes decrease.
